BYD Surpasses Tesla in 2024 Revenue, Solidifying Global EV Market Leadership
The Chinese automaker reported $107.2 billion in revenue, driven by European expansion and advanced battery technology, but faces EU regulatory scrutiny and geopolitical challenges.
- BYD's 2024 revenue reached $107.2 billion, a 29% increase from 2023, surpassing Tesla's $97.7 billion for the year.
- The company has aggressively expanded in Europe, launching a new compact EV model and unveiling ultra-fast charging technology capable of a five-minute charge for 470 kilometers of range.
- BYD's new 1,000-kilowatt 'Super e-Platform' battery technology has boosted investor confidence, with its Hong Kong-listed shares hitting record highs.
- Tesla continues to face declining sales in Europe, partly attributed to CEO Elon Musk's controversial political affiliations impacting the brand's perception.
- BYD faces challenges from an EU investigation into alleged unfair subsidies for its Hungary factory and broader geopolitical tensions between China and Western nations.
